Every Move

by Ellie Marney

Age rating: Ages 15–17 · Young Adults

Age rating and Christian content guidance for parents.

First published 2015

A teenage girl navigates a dangerous situation involving a stalker and her own past.

Things to consider

Sexual Content40

There are implied sexual situations and discussions.

Violence / Gore50

The protagonist faces physical threats and fear.

Profanity / Language40

Moderate profanity is present in dialogue and narration.

Blasphemy0

No blasphemy is present in the story.

Substance Use0

Substance use is not a significant theme.

Suicide & Self-Harm10

The protagonist experiences significant psychological distress.

Scary / Disturbing60

The suspense and threat create a scary atmosphere.
